Abstract

A method for enrolling devices in a security system based upon RFID techniques. The method prevents unauthorized devices from engaging in communications by and between the various devices in the security system. While the security system may have long RF range during normal operation, the RFID readers of the security system reduce their read range during an enrollment operation. A user must be physically proximate to an RFID reader to enroll any device. The controller has an associated master key RFID transponder containing at least one code necessary for enabling enrollment of an RFID reader. This master key RFID transponder can only be read during enrollment. RFID transponders and RFID readers also exchange at least one code during the enrollment of RFID transponders. The codes can enable encrypted communications during normal system operation.

Claims (50)

1. A method of enrolling devices in a security system containing at least a first controller and at least two other devices, a first RFID reader having a read zone and a first RFID transponder, the method comprising the steps of:

placing the first controller into an enrollment made;

reducing the transmit power of the first RFID reader to reduce its read zone to an area proximate to the first RFID reader;

placing the first RFID transponder within the reduced read zone of the first RFID reader;

further reducing the transmit power of the first RFID reader, thereby narrowing the size and shape of the read zone, until the first RFID reader detects only the first RFID transponder;

still further reducing the transmit power of the first RFID reader to a predetermined threshold which assures that the first RFID transponder is physically close to the first RFID reader;

exchanging information between the first RFID reader and the first RFID transponder; and

using the exchanged information to enroll a device in the first controller of the security system.
